About Pei Xiao
Pei Xiao is a scholar working on Gastroenterology, Complementary and alternative medicine and Oral Surgery, having authored 32 papers that have together received 993 indexed citations. Recurring topics across this work include Circular RNAs in diseases (5 papers), MicroRNA in disease regulation (4 papers), Cancer-related molecular mechanisms research (4 papers), Gastrointestinal motility and disorders (3 papers), Dental Implant Techniques and Outcomes (3 papers), Traditional Chinese Medicine Analysis (3 papers), Clostridium difficile and Clostridium perfringens research (3 papers) and Pharmacological Effects of Natural Compounds (2 papers). The work is most often cited by research in Cancer Research (293 citations), Pharmacology (138 citations) and Complementary and alternative medicine (97 citations). Pei Xiao has collaborated with scholars based in China, United States and Yemen. Frequent co-authors include Da‐Cheng Hao, Yingnan Ye, Jinpu Yu, Lijie Zhang, Xin-Xin Long, Junya Ning, Wenwen Yu, Xuanyu Chen, Li Chen and Xuegang Wang. Their work appears in journals such as Clinical Cancer Research, Environmental Pollution and RSC Advances.
